2ND DIVISION, SWEDISH ARMY

Coat of arms (crest) of the 2nd Division, Swedish Army

Official blazon

Fältet genom vågskuror två gånger delat av grönt, silver och blått; i silverfältet en gående svart varg.

(Per fess wavy vert, argent and azure, the argent field charged with a wolf passant sable).

Origin/meaning

The Division which was disbanded in 1997 was also known as the Lower Northern Division. The design symbolises the Northern Areas of Sweden which was the location of the Division. Behind was placed Command Batons which was the symbol of the Divisions. The Arms was approved in 1995.
